The 24 Hour California Teams

Sometimes, we come across a cause and organization that makes us go beyond our comfort zones, and bite off something more than we normally might not do. This weekend, two teams in California will be paddling a 24hour relay. One in Morro Bay, and one in Newport as part of the Monster and Sea Paddle for Cancer cause happening across the nation. We wanted to take a moment to shine some light on these awesome Cali Paddlers and the adventure they will be embarking on. Have fun out there! Team Morro Bay:

24 Hour Paddle Team Morro Bay

Stanley is Morro Bay native/local and has surfed all of his life. He enjoys golf, mtn biking & road biking, and took up paddle boarding and paddle surfing about two years ago. Stanley's career history has included: construction, farming, and 28 years as a Licensed Real Estate Agent/Broker. Stanley is active in the Morro Bay community as a member of the MB Rotary Club, MB Yacht Club, and the Rock Harbor Church of MB. Stanley also gives back to the community by working as a reserve fireman. Stanley is father-in-law to MB Paddle Team Captain, Teddy.

Trevor grew up in Morro Bay and has been surfing for over 25 years. With his love for the ocean and water sports, it was a natural transition over to standup paddle boarding. Trevor works as master carpenter and gives back to the community by working as a reserve firefighter/paramedic. The local community of SUP's is growing along the Central Coast and he is stoked to be a part of it.

Ken co-founded the Paddleboard Company in Morro Bay with his wife Sandi. Ken works in the technology industry for a major company. He is an accomplished paddler who has SUP'd the Mentawai Islands in Indonesia, Hawaii, Alaska, the Big Sur Coast from Point Sur to Cayucos, as well as various lakes and rivers in the US. Ken and The Paddleboard Company are passionate supporters of local charities, clean water advocacy groups, and causes like the Monster and Sea 24.

Sandi took up standup paddle boarding 6 yrs ago while living on the Big Island of Hawaii. This sport along with yoga are the foundation of her fitness which led her to get a certification as a SUP yoga instructor.   Sandi, along with her husband, Ken, own The Paddleboard Company, a SUP retail and rental store in Morro Bay to help share their love of the sport. They offer rentals and lessons for the "curious", sales and demos for the "serious" and classes, events and tours for the "adventurous". As a certified ACE Personal Trainer and 200RYT yoga instructor Sandi enjoys working outside on a liquid studio to help people "find their balance".

Jeff, Morro Bay native and avid surfer/paddle boarder spends his workdays as a journeyman electrician. Jeff has worked on large job sites including solar and nuclear energy plants, institutions, and industrial complexes. In his free time, he enjoys family beach days, camping with family and at any given time, isn't too far from good music or the beach. Jeff has been paddle boarding for about three years and is a part of the growing Central Coast SUP community.

Teddy, Morro Bay local and MB paddle team captain, has surfed nearly all his life. About three years ago he and a few guys from his firehouse swapped mountain bikes for SUP's and started out with some flat water paddling that progressed to paddle surfing. Teddy enjoys a career on the Central Coast as a fire engineer/paramedic and works out of a firehouse with Stanley and Trevor. Teddy is co-founder of ESTERO and ESTEROpaddle.com , a surf/SUP/paddle surf apparel company that gives to a local charity group assisting wounded active military personnel and veterans. He enjoys family beach days and paddling with his 4 year-old son.
